    Switch access protection port

    To block unauthorized access to switch ports, switches support a feature called port security. This feature allows you to configure which devices are allowed or blocked on each port. Switch Port Security is the security mechanism used in switches. With this mechanism, a specific port of a switch can be protected with undesirable access. Whether you're working on a small LAN setup or enterprise-grade infrastructure, enforcing MAC address-level access at the port can go a long way in preventing unauthorized access and network abuse.

  • Check port status on the aggregation switch

    Check port status on the aggregation switch

    To see the summary information on all ports on the switch, enter the show interface status command with no arguments.
